Well-planned sanctuary with upscale club and mountain nature trails

“Living in Madeira Canyon,” says John Diaz, Realtor and Team Owner of the Diaz Luxe Group with Douglas Elliman Real Estate, who lived in Madeira Canyon for eight years, “you’re tucked away, surrounded by mountains and so off the beaten path that you don’t venture out there if you don’t live there. It’s so quiet and serene.” Resting on elevated terrain that backs to Black Mountain and the Sloan National Conservation Area, the neighborhood is fully built out and includes two gated communities. Curving streets encircle a city park that’s loaded with recreation options, and the neighborhood is bordered by miles of trails. Neighbors take long walks around the community or into the hills. From the heart of this scenic and sequestered community, shopping and dining options are just 2 miles north. Residents can easily connect with Interstates 215 and 15 to reach the Las Vegas Strip and Harry Reid International Airport.

Gated and nongated options

Madeira Canyon is designed to blend into its natural surroundings, using water-smart landscaping. Neat sidewalks lined with palms, desert-hardy shrubs and pebbles connect this bikeable, walkable neighborhood. Within its master plan, Videiras is a guard-gated enclave of less than 100 homes, most with private swimming pools, ranging from $800,000 to $1.25 million based on number of bedrooms and proximity to the protected natural areas. Homes in the guard-gated Club at Madeira, also known as “The Club” or “Club M,” enjoy a mountain and canyon backdrop and generally fetch between $900,000 and $1.3 million. This active adult community with roaming security is comprised of 546 homes, all with exclusive privileges at the community clubhouse. “From the Club at Madeira clubhouse,” adds Diaz, who’s been selling in the area since 2017, “you get unbelievable, unobstructed views of the valley and the Strip. At nighttime, it’s exquisite.” Homes throughout the rest of Madeira Canyon, some of which are considered part of the Anthem area, can range from $550,000 to $700,000 based on size and number of bedrooms.

Madeira Canyon Park, private clubhouse, miles of trails

“You’re also right by the best park in Henderson if you ask me,” says Diaz. “Madeira Canyon Park is city-owned, so all residents can use it, and it’s on top of a mountain, giving you a great view of the Strip.” Resident athletes take advantage of the multiple lighted baseball fields and tennis courts. Kids play on the shade-covered playset and splash pad. Less than a mile from the park, bicyclists and dog-walkers hop on the paved Nevada Power Trail. “Black Mountain Trail,” says Diaz, “leads to an awesome peak. And it’s so hilly that there’s not going to be any building there because of the terrain. You can go out into the mountains any time, bring your dogs, and there’s a notebook at the top of the mountain in a metal box like an old-school lunchbox. When people get up there, they write in the notebook.”

The Madeira Canyon Clubhouse in Club M is also situated up on a hill to capture amazing views. This large, exclusive facility includes a community library, state-of-the-art fitness center, massage room and catering kitchen inside. Outside, Club M residents have access to parks, trails, sports courts and a resort-style community pool. “We also have monthly events and our pickleball courts are really popular,” says Candy Cortes, general manager at the Club at Madeira Canyon.

Anthem Highlands plaza for shopping and dining

The Anthem Highlands Shopping Center sits 2 miles north of Madeira Canyon Park. It’s the hub for pick-me-ups at Starbucks or New Day Café, grocery shopping at Albertsons or casual dinner at China Tango. For some entertainment while eating, gaming machines at PT’s Gold and Rounders Bicentennial offer a taste of Las Vegas. When locals are looking for date nights beyond the Anthem Highlands Shopping Center, says Diaz, “People go down Eastern Avenue. I call it Restaurant Row. It’s this 2-mile strip where you can find every type of cuisine, and it’s within a 10-minute drive. Also, you can go about 7 miles north to Rose Parkway, and there’s this cool place called Nacho Daddy. They have everything from Asian-style nachos to Indian curry nachos, and it’s a really cool vibe. Plus, it’s a local business that started right here.” Despite all the options in downtown Vegas and The Strip, many residents choose to stick around their own neighborhood. “Vegas is known for lights and noise,” says Diaz, “and in Madeira Canyon, you have so much peace — but you’re still within arm’s reach of The Strip. Locals might head into the Strip once a year, for an anniversary or birthday, or now for big sporting events. But people who live here mostly stay local. Eastern Avenue can supply all your needs.”

Liberty High football champs, B-plus schools

Public schools are within the Clark County School District, given a B on Niche. All three schools in the Madeira Canyon pipeline earn a Niche B-plus. Kids start at Shirley and Bill Wallin Elementary, which is walkable in the neighborhood, and head to Del E. Webb Middle. High schoolers go to Liberty, which Diaz says is known to have one of the top high school football programs in the nation. “It’s not only the unique terrain that draws people here,” says Diaz. “It’s also these great schools. The elementary isn’t private, but it has high standards like you’d expect from a private school and fantastic teachers. And when you live where the schools are this good, the odds of your home maintaining its value are also really good.”

Close to the 15 and Henderson Executive Airport

Residents can connect with Interstate 215 within a 9-mile drive from central Madiera Canyon and travel another 9 miles or so to reach the Las Vegas Strip via Interstate 15, for a total commute of around 30 to 45 minutes. From Madeira Canyon Park, Harry Reid International Airport is within a 14-mile drive north. The private Henderson Executive Airport is only about 6 miles northwest. “People love to see private jets or hobbyists,” says Diaz, “coming in and out of Henderson airport. It’s fun.” The new West Henderson Hospital, scheduled to open in late 2024 on Raiders Way, is about a mile or so from Henderson Executive Airport.

Holiday gatherings, clubhouse Spring Fling and potlucks

Some of the most cherished events in Madeira Canyon are holiday gatherings in the parks for the Fourth of July, Christmas and Easter. Neighbors also gather at the Club M clubhouse for an annual Spring Fling every March, outdoor movie nights in summer and fall potlucks.
